Washington's climate, characterized by wet, mild winters and dry, warm summers, means your HVAC system is used for both heating and cooling. This continuous operation circulates air, drawing in and depositing dust, pollen, and other airborne particles within your ductwork. Our systematic cleaning process removes this buildup, aiming to improve the air quality within your home.
In Seattle, common signs that your air ducts need cleaning include visible dust around vents, a noticeable increase in household dust, or recurring musty odors when your HVAC system is operating. If you or your family members experience increased allergy or respiratory symptoms, dirty ducts may be a contributing factor.
